Cách Hạ Cấp Firmware Mazda Connect Cho Người Dùng

Downgrade firmware Mazda Connect có thể thực hiện được nếu bạn biết đúng quy trình và chuẩn bị đủ công cụ; bài viết này sẽ chỉ ra cách thực hiện chi tiết, các phiên bản hỗ trợ, công cụ cần thiết, rủi ro và cách khắc phục.
Tiếp theo, chúng ta sẽ liệt kê các phiên bản firmware Mazda Connect mà người dùng có thể hạ cấp, đồng thời giải thích giới hạn rollback của một số bản mới.
Sau đó, phần hướng dẫn sẽ giới thiệu các công cụ, phần mềm và thiết bị chuẩn bị trước khi bắt tay vào downgrade.
Cuối cùng, bài viết sẽ tổng hợp các rủi ro, lưu ý quan trọng và cách khắc phục nếu gặp sự cố, giúp bạn tự tin thực hiện mà không lo “brick” hệ thống. Dưới đây là toàn bộ thông tin bạn cần để thực hiện downgrade firmware Mazda Connect một cách an toàn và hiệu quả.

Các phiên bản firmware Mazda Connect có thể hạ cấp

Phiên bản firmware Mazda Connect là phần mềm điều khiển trung tâm giải trí, âm thanh và các tính năng kết nối trong xe. Việc biết phiên bản nào có thể hạ cấp giúp bạn tránh được những giới hạn do nhà sản xuất đặt ra.

Phiên bản 59.00.502 và các phiên bản trước

Có một loạt các phiên bản cũ hơn 59.00.502 mà Mazda vẫn cho phép người dùng cài đặt lại thông qua cổng USB tiêu chuẩn. Những bản này thường không có cơ chế bảo vệ rollback, do đó việc downgrade trở nên đơn giản. Đặc điểm chính của các phiên bản này bao gồm giao diện người dùng truyền thống, không hỗ trợ một số tính năng mới như Apple CarPlay nâng cấp.

Xem thêm  So Sánh Mazda Cx-9: Đánh Giá, Giá Và Ưu Nhược Điểm

Phiên bản 70.00.367 trở lên và giới hạn rollback

Phiên bản 70.00.367 trở lên đã được Mazda tích hợp cơ chế “firmware lock” ngăn người dùng quay lại phiên bản cũ hơn. Khi cố gắng cài đặt một file firmware thấp hơn, hệ thống sẽ tự động từ chối và hiển thị thông báo lỗi. Điều này nhằm bảo vệ tính ổn định và an toàn, nhưng cũng gây bất tiện cho những ai muốn quay lại phiên bản cũ vì vấn đề tương thích phần cứng. Để bypass giới hạn này, người dùng cần dùng phương pháp lập trình lại chip SPI NOR hoặc kết nối serial tới mô-đun CMU – hai cách sẽ được trình bày chi tiết trong phần Supplementary Content.

Công cụ và phần mềm cần chuẩn bị để downgrade

Để thực hiện downgrade firmware Mazda Connect, bạn cần chuẩn bị đầy đủ các công cụ phần cứng và phần mềm tương thích. Việc chuẩn bị đúng sẽ giảm thiểu rủi ro và tăng khả năng thành công.

USB FAT32, file .kwi và phần mềm cập nhật

Bạn cần một ổ USB định dạng FAT32, dung lượng tối thiểu 8 GB, để lưu trữ file firmware có đuôi .kwi. Phần mềm cập nhật chính thức của Mazda, thường được gọi là “Mazda Connect Update Tool”, cho phép bạn tải file .kwi lên hệ thống qua cổng USB. Đảm bảo rằng file firmware được đặt đúng thư mục “UPDATE” trên USB, và tên file không chứa ký tự đặc biệt.

Thiết bị lập trình SPI NOR và phần mềm flash

Khi đối mặt với phiên bản có bảo vệ rollback, bạn sẽ cần một thiết bị lập trình SPI NOR (như CH341A) để truy cập và ghi lại nội dung chip nhớ của CMU. Phần mềm flash như “Flashrom” hoặc “Winbond Flash Programmer” hỗ trợ đọc/ghi các đoạn nhớ NAND hoặc NOR. Kết nối thiết bị lập trình tới board CMU yêu cầu tháo rời cài đặt nội thất xe, vì vậy nên thực hiện trong môi trường sạch sẽ, không có tĩnh điện.

Cách Hạ Cấp Firmware Mazda Connect Cho Người Dùng
Cách Hạ Cấp Firmware Mazda Connect Cho Người Dùng

Quy trình hạ cấp firmware chi tiết từng bước

Quy trình downgrade bao gồm bốn bước chính, mỗi bước cần thực hiện cẩn thận để tránh làm hỏng hệ thống.

Bước 1 – Sao lưu firmware hiện tại

Bạn nên sao lưu firmware hiện tại trước khi thay đổi bất kỳ dữ liệu nào. Kết nối thiết bị lập trình SPI NOR tới CMU, mở phần mềm flash và thực hiện “Read” toàn bộ chip, lưu file .bin với tên mô tả phiên bản hiện tại (ví dụ: Mazda_74.00.311.bin). Việc này giúp bạn khôi phục lại phiên bản gốc nếu quá trình downgrade gặp lỗi.

Bước 2 – Chuẩn bị file firmware cũ trên USB

Sau khi đã có bản sao lưu, tải file firmware cũ từ nguồn uy tín (cộng đồng mazdatweaks, diễn đàn Mazda) và kiểm tra checksum MD5 để đảm bảo không bị hỏng. Đặt file .kwi vào thư mục “UPDATE” trên USB FAT32, sau đó gắn USB vào cổng USB của Mazda Connect.

Bước 3 – Thực hiện downgrade qua cổng OBD hoặc serial

Có hai cách phổ biến để đưa firmware cũ vào hệ thống:
Qua cổng OBD-II: Sử dụng phần mềm “Mazda OBD Flash” kết nối với một adapter OBD (ví dụ: Vgate iCar). Phần mềm sẽ nhận file .kwi từ USB và ghi lên ECU thông qua giao thức CAN.
Kết nối serial tới CMU: Đối với các phiên bản không cho phép downgrade qua OBD, bạn có thể mở cổng serial trên board CMU và sử dụng công cụ “MazdaSerialFlash”. Kết nối serial, chạy lệnh flash và chờ quá trình hoàn tất.

Xem thêm  Jarkeys Mazda: Đánh Giá Chi Tiết Các Loại Chìa Khóa Xe Mazda 2026

Bước 4 – Kiểm tra và khôi phục chức năng hệ thống

Sau khi flash xong, khởi động lại Mazda Connect và kiểm tra các chức năng: màn hình hiển thị, radio, Bluetooth, và các tùy chọn cài đặt. Nếu gặp lỗi “Firmware mismatch” hoặc hệ thống không khởi động, sử dụng file sao lưu từ Bước 1 để flash lại phiên bản gốc.

Rủi ro, lưu ý và cách khắc phục sau khi downgrade

Downgrade firmware không phải lúc nào cũng suôn sẻ; việc hiểu rõ rủi ro và cách xử lý sẽ giúp bạn tránh những hậu quả nghiêm trọng.

Cách Hạ Cấp Firmware Mazda Connect Cho Người Dùng
Cách Hạ Cấp Firmware Mazda Connect Cho Người Dùng

Có nguy cơ brick CMU không?

Có, việc flash sai phiên bản hoặc lỗi trong quá trình ghi có thể làm CMU (Central Multimedia Unit) “brick”, nghĩa là không khởi động được. Nguyên nhân thường là do mất nguồn điện trong quá trình flash hoặc dùng file firmware không tương thích. Để giảm thiểu nguy cơ, luôn sử dụng nguồn điện ổn định (bạn có thể kết nối bình 12 V qua cáp phụ) và kiểm tra kỹ checksum của file trước khi flash.

Các lỗi thường gặp và cách xử lý

  • Lỗi “Firmware version not supported”: Thường xuất hiện khi cố gắng downgrade phiên bản có bảo vệ rollback. Giải pháp là dùng phương pháp SPI NOR re‑programming để xóa flag bảo vệ.
  • Màn hình treo, âm thanh không phát: Kiểm tra lại kết nối USB, đảm bảo file .kwi không bị hỏng. Nếu vẫn không hoạt động, flash lại phiên bản gốc từ bản sao lưu.
  • Không nhận tín hiệu OBD: Đảm bảo adapter OBD tương thích với giao thức Mazda, và driver đã được cài đặt đúng trên máy tính.

Các phương pháp nâng cao để bypass giới hạn firmware Mazda

Nếu bạn muốn hạ cấp các phiên bản mà Mazda đã khóa, có một số phương pháp nâng cao được cộng đồng chia sẻ. Mỗi phương pháp có mức độ an toàn và độ phức tạp khác nhau, vì vậy hãy cân nhắc trước khi thực hiện.

Sử dụng re‑programming SPI NOR

Phương pháp này yêu cầu thiết bị lập trình SPI NOR và phần mềm flash. Bạn sẽ đọc toàn bộ nội dung chip, xóa các flag bảo vệ (thường nằm ở offset 0x3C), sau đó ghi lại firmware cũ. Đây là cách an toàn nhất vì nó không thay đổi cấu trúc phần cứng, chỉ thay đổi dữ liệu lưu trữ.

Kết nối serial tới CMU với mazdatweaks

Mazdatweaks là một dự án mã nguồn mở cho phép giao tiếp trực tiếp với CMU qua cổng serial. Bằng cách sử dụng lệnh “unlock” trong mazdatweaks, bạn có thể tạm thời vô hiệu hoá cơ chế rollback, sau đó flash firmware cũ. Phương pháp này yêu cầu kiến thức về lập trình serial và một chút kinh nghiệm mở xe.

Xem thêm  Đối tác Toyota Mazda: Tại sao hai ô tô lớn lại hợp tác?

Thay đổi file .kwi để giảm phiên bản

Một cách đơn giản hơn là chỉnh sửa file .kwi bằng hex editor, thay đổi thông tin version trong header. Tuy nhiên, cách này chỉ hoạt động nếu hệ thống không kiểm tra checksum nội bộ. Nếu checksum không khớp, hệ thống sẽ từ chối cài đặt.

So sánh độ an toàn giữa các phương pháp

Cách Hạ Cấp Firmware Mazda Connect Cho Người Dùng
Cách Hạ Cấp Firmware Mazda Connect Cho Người Dùng
Phương phápĐộ an toànĐộ khó thực hiệnYêu cầu thiết bị
Re‑programming SPI NORCao (không thay đổi firmware core)Trung bìnhProgrammer SPI, phần mềm flash
Serial + mazdatweaksTrung bình (cần mở CMU)CaoCáp serial, phần mềm mazdatweaks
Chỉnh file .kwiThấp (rủi ro checksum)ThấpHex editor
Kết hợp OBD + scriptTrung bìnhTrung bìnhAdapter OBD, script flash

Câu hỏi thường gặp

Tôi có nên hạ cấp firmware Mazda Connect nếu phiên bản hiện tại ổn định không?

Nếu hệ thống hiện tại hoạt động ổn định và bạn không gặp vấn đề nào, việc hạ cấp không mang lại lợi ích đáng kể. Tuy nhiên, nếu bạn cần một tính năng đã bị loại bỏ trong phiên bản mới hoặc muốn khôi phục tương thích với phần cứng cũ, downgrade có thể là lựa chọn hợp lý.

Làm sao để biết phiên bản firmware hiện tại của xe?

Bạn có thể kiểm tra phiên bản firmware bằng cách vào menu “Settings” → “System Information” trên màn hình Mazda Connect. Thông tin sẽ hiển thị dưới dạng “Firmware Version: xx.xx.xxx”. Ngoài ra, phần mềm OBD-II cũng có thể đọc thông tin này qua giao thức CAN.

Khi nào nên sử dụng phương pháp serial connection thay vì USB?

Phương pháp serial connection thường được dùng khi firmware mới đã bật tính năng rollback, khiến USB không thể ghi xuống. Serial cho phép bạn truy cập trực tiếp vào bộ nhớ CMU, bỏ qua các lớp bảo vệ phần mềm. Nếu bạn không muốn tháo rời nội thất xe, USB vẫn là lựa chọn tiện lợi.

Nếu xe không khởi động sau downgrade, tôi có thể khôi phục lại như thế nào?

Đầu tiên, kết nối thiết bị lập trình SPI NOR và flash lại bản sao lưu firmware gốc mà bạn đã tạo ở Bước 1. Nếu không có bản sao lưu, hãy tìm phiên bản firmware gốc trên diễn đàn Mazda và flash lại bằng OBD hoặc serial. Trong trường hợp vẫn không khởi động, nên mang xe tới trung tâm dịch vụ Mazda để kiểm tra phần cứng.

Lưu ý quan trọng: Nội dung bài viết này chỉ mang tính chất tham khảo và cung cấp thông tin chung. Đây không phải lời khuyên kỹ thuật chuyên nghiệp. Mọi quyết định quan trọng liên quan đến việc sửa đổi phần mềm xe của bạn nên được thực hiện sau khi tham khảo ý kiến trực tiếp từ kỹ thuật viên Mazda có chuyên môn.

Hy vọng những thông tin trên giúp bạn nắm rõ quy trình và lưu ý khi hạ cấp firmware Mazda Connect. Nếu bạn còn thắc mắc, hãy xem lại các phần FAQ hoặc tìm kiếm hỗ trợ trên cộng đồng mazdatweaks trước khi thực hiện.

Cập Nhật Lúc Tháng 4 14, 2026 by Huỳnh Thanh Vi

Để lại một bình luận

Email của bạn sẽ không được hiển thị công khai. Các trường bắt buộc được đánh dấu *